UBC Library acquires a copy of the Kelmscott Chaucer

By michelle blackwell on August 23, 2016

UBC Library has acquired a copy of the Kelmscott Chaucer, one of the world’s most extraordinary books. Printed in a limited edition of only 438 copies, the Works of Geoffrey Chaucer was published by William Morris’s Kelmscott Press in 1896.
